I am using an old Samsung phone to make calls.

 

When I view the Contatcts, am I seeing what is on the phone, or what is on the SIM? Can I view either?

It depends.
Normally there is a setting within contacts to see either SIM, phone or both.
Sometimes it is useful and tells you a number next to the option - this is the number stored in that place.

Using Phonebook options While viewing contact details, press to access the following options: • Edit: edit contact information. Menu functions Phonebook (Menu 2) 31 • Send message: send an SMS or MMS message to the selected number, or an e-mail to the selected address. • Copy to: copy the contact to the phone’s memory or to the SIM card. • Send via: send the contact via SMS, MMS, e-mail, or Bluetooth. • Delete: delete the selected contact.
